I am thinking of moving to the Dormont or Mt. Lebanon area and i need to commute downtown for work everyday, but i have never taken the T out that way so i have a few questions about it. I tried to look for a T schedule on the port authority website and i can't seem to find one.

My first question is how late does the T run on weekdays and on weekends?? Is it the same times as the bus system or later? Is there a schedule of the times it runs anywhere?

Also, I currently have a zone one monthly bus pass. Would i be able to use my pass to ride on the T from Pittsburgh to Dormont?

Dormont and Mt. Lebanon are on the Beechview line of the "T". The 42C and 42S serve that line. Below is a link to a pdf schedule. Dormont is in Zone One.

From Dormont, you can also take the West Liberty Ave. busses depending on where you end up at- I think its the 41 and it isn't a bad trip. It goes up the old streetcar ramp to the South Busway and through the streetcar tunnel to Station Square and to town.
